2014 was an exciting and eventful year. As the number of TSG cities expanded (we now have guides to forty-nine locations in print!), our team of editors across the country grew as well, and through them our network of unique and talented artists, artisans, experts, and entrepreneurs has become stronger, deeper, and more extensive than ever. In addition to welcoming new cities, we celebrated the launches of the second and third volumes in many TSG locations—occasions every bit as thrilling since we’ve had the pleasure of getting to know the faces behind the places featured in the books, and always look forward to meeting the newcomers shown alongside them.
